I have a very fine polishing compound / swirl remover that I've used to hand buff satin necks on my Martin acoustics. I've actually buffed out satin bodies and tops as well. I prefer the gloss look and feel over the satin.

I'm wondering if anyone has polished out a satin neck on a newer G&L guitar. What I'm mostly concerned about is the headstock. I don't want to get into the logo / decal. On the Martins, I carefully polish right over the logo, with no issues, and they have a fairly thin finish, as it appears the G&L does as well.
